Kothagudem: Superintendent of Police, B Rohith Raju handed over cash reward cheques to seven surrendered cadres of CPI (Maoist) here on Monday.

Podium Mangu alias Devender of Bijapur district, Sodi Pojji alias Chiluka and Madivi Somidi alias Ramya of Sukuma district in Chhattisgarh were each given a cash cheque worth Rs 4 lakh along with Madakam Adime alias Anusha of Cherla mandal in Kothagudem district.


Madakam Idumaiah alias Mahesh of Allapalli mandal, Lakshmaiah alias Kallu of Cherla mandal and Koram Somaiah alias Soma of Yetapaka mandal in Alluri Sitaramaraju district of Andhra Pradesh were each given a cash cheque worth Rs 1 lakh.

The SP informed that 26 Maoists who surrendered during the year 2023-2024 were given reward money sanctioned by the Telangana government for their rehabilitation. Top leaders of the Maoist party for selfish purposes with outdated ideologies were forcing innocent tribals to join their party to do illegal activities. The district police would always stand by the surrendered Maoists, he said.

Rohith Raju appealed to Maoist leaders and cadres to lay down their arms and fight for the rights of the people democratically. Those who wanted to surrender and lead a normal life should surrender either through their relatives, local police officials or before the SP.

Steps would be taken by the police to ensure that those who have surrendered receive all kinds of rewards on behalf of the government. Additional SP (Operations) T Sai Manohar, Dummugudem CI Ashok and Cherla CI Raju Varma were present.
